Stale-branch cleanup: the Tidygrove bot runs every Sunday at 02:00 and deletes branches with no commits in 90 days, excluding anything matching `release/*` or `hotfix/*`. Before forcing a manual run, verify the exclusion list in the bot config was reloaded, because an outdated cache once deleted a protected branch. Every deletion batch is auditable via the trace token printed beneath this entry.

pipeline stamp: htk31_f769b577b3028a4e9958e5bb8d1259a

Subject: Stale-branch cleanup bot — rollout update

Team,

Ahead of the weekly sync: the Brambleshear cleanup bot is now live on the Fernhollow monorepo. It flags branches with no commits in 90 days, posts a warning, and deletes after a 14-day grace window. Protected and release branches are excluded via the config in the tooling repo. We dry-ran it twice and reviewed the candidate list with each team lead. The deployed version corresponds to the build noted below.

pipeline stamp: htk9_ce63042d9

**Q: What are the opening hours over the holiday period?**

From 24 December to 2 January, Fennick House operates reduced hours: doors open 08:00–16:00 on working days and remain fully closed on public holidays. Reception at the Oakline Building is unstaffed during this window, so plan deliveries accordingly. New starters needing access outside these hours must book in advance and enter via the east door using the code below.

staff pass of kawip-hawef = bdg-QLP-2